small weevil - Dryophthorus americanus

small weevil - Dryophthorus americanus
Harvard, Worcester County, Massachusetts, USA
March 12, 2006
Size: 3.5mm
Found a bunch of these weevils living with an ant colony, under bark on a big old pine log.

Curculionidae: Dryophthorus americanus
Thought I had identified this earlier, but apparently not so. Commonly found under/in dead conifer bark.
